Page 1 sur 1

[RESOLU]Script player non fonctionnel

Publié : 14 Fév 2020 16:02
par Alkyssprod
Hello,

J'ai tenté de créer un script trouvé sur YouTube pour une vidéo vr.
Mais Unity m'indique une erreur :

Assets/Script/Player.cs(4,6): error CS1001: Identifier expected

Voici le script :

Code : Tout sélectionner



using System.Collections;
using System.Collections.Generic;
using UnityEngine;
using.UnityEngine.Video;

public class VideoManager : MonoBehaviour
{
 
 private VideoPlayer videoPlayer;
 private void Start()

    {
        videoPlayer = GetCompenent<VideoPlayer>();

    }

    
public void Play()
    {
        videoPlayer.Play();
    }

    public void Stop()
    {
        videoPlayer.Stop();
    }

    public void Pause()
    {
        videoPlayer.Pause();
    }
}

Re: Script player non fonctionnel

Publié : 14 Fév 2020 16:13
par Max
Bonjour,

A vue de nez, je dirais un point placé où il ne faudrait pas, donc au lieu de using.UnityEngine.Video;
écrire plutôt using UnityEngine.Video;.
Si tu utilises VisualStudio, normalement c'est le genre d'erreur de syntaxe qu'il doit te souligner en rouge.

PS: pense aux balises code quand tu en poste un.

Re: Script player non fonctionnel

Publié : 14 Fév 2020 17:09
par Alkyssprod
Merci :)

Ca c'est corrigé mais j'ai de nouveau de erreurs?
Je pense que c'est vis à vis du nom VideoPlayer ?

Code : Tout sélectionner

using System.Collections;
using System.Collections.Generic;
using UnityEngine;
using UnityEngine.Video;

public class VideoManager : MonoBehaviour

{
 
 private VideoPlayer videoPlayer;

 private void Start()

    {
        videoPlayer = GetCompenent<VideoPlayer>();

    }

    
public void Play()
    {
        videoPlayer.Play();
    }

    public void Stop()
    {
        videoPlayer.Stop();
    }

    public void Pause()
    {
        videoPlayer.Pause();
    }
}

Re: Script player non fonctionnel

Publié : 14 Fév 2020 17:28
par Max
Tu n'as pas deux fois le script VideoManager.cs dans ton projet des fois ?

Sinon, encore une erreur de syntaxe, ce n'est pas GetCompenent<> mais GetComponent<>

Re: Script player non fonctionnel

Publié : 14 Fév 2020 18:07
par Alkyssprod
lol Yes merci j'ai pu corriger a entre temps.

Ca m'apprendra à pas bien regarder. J'"ai pas encore les réflexes "visuels" ou connaissances aguerri :p

Par contre je pense que le problème de mes boutons non clivables c'est parce que ma caméra est a l'intérieur d'une sphère 3D Non ?

J'ai l'impression que le Canvas est "derrière" la sphère dans laquelle est la caméra ? Je sais pas trop expliquer le problème.

Re: Script player non fonctionnel

Publié : 14 Fév 2020 18:22
par Max
Alkyssprod a écrit :
14 Fév 2020 18:07
Par contre je pense que le problème de mes boutons non clivables c'est parce que ma caméra est a l'intérieur d'une sphère 3D Non ?

J'ai l'impression que le Canvas est "derrière" la sphère dans laquelle est la caméra ? Je sais pas trop expliquer le problème.
tu as regardé ma réponse sur le sujet ?

Re: Script player non fonctionnel

Publié : 15 Fév 2020 01:55
par Alkyssprod
Oui concernant les deux scripts similaires. J'ai bien enlevé un des scripts.

Et j'ai bien changé GetComponent.

Mais toujours rien...

Re: Script player non fonctionnel

Publié : 15 Fév 2020 09:44
par Max
Bonjour,

pour l'histoire du bouton, je parlais de la réponse faite au niveau du sujet dans la section GUI que tu as ouvert: viewtopic.php?f=9&p=121287&sid=89200853 ... b1#p121287